12. Cell Membrane: This is the first line of defence for a cell. It is made up of lipids and proteins. Lipids give the membrane flexibility whereas proteins assist in the movement of nutrients across the membrane. The membrane is selectively permeable. It allows necessary compounds to pass and restricts entry of harmful substances that can affect the cell adversely.
13. Smooth Endoplasmic Reticulum: The smooth ER is responsible for the synthesis of lipids, such as cholesterol and phospholipids, which helps form all membranes of an organism. In addition, it is also involved in carbohydrate metabolism. An enzyme from smooth ER catalyses the production of glucose from glucose-6-phosphate.
14. Lipids: Lipids and fats are only around 2-20% of the weight of algae. When they get accumulated in phytoplanktons above this value, they being lighter than water, reduce the overall density of the cells thus making them more bouyant than usual.
15. Fats have 9 cal/g and carbohydrates have 4 cal/g energy content. A reason for this is that carbohydrates are easily oxidised and provide energy more quickly. Fats require more oxidation to completely oxidise than carbohydrates. Because of this, oxidation of fats takes longer but it also provides more energy.
